Which three features can you use in Interactive View mode of BusinessObjects Web Intelligence 4.0?

The correct answer is A. Sort B. Filters C. Format Cell. Interactive View mode in Web Intelligence 4.0 supports presentation and filtering features like Sort, Filters, and Format Cell, but excludes data-modeling operations that require Edit mode.

Why each option

Interactive View mode in Web Intelligence 4.0 supports presentation and filtering features like Sort, Filters, and Format Cell, but excludes data-modeling operations that require Edit mode.

ASortCorrect

Sort is available in Interactive View mode, allowing users to reorder data in tables and charts without needing full Edit mode access to the report.

BFiltersCorrect

Filters can be applied and modified in Interactive View mode, enabling users to restrict the data displayed in the report while remaining in the interactive view.

CFormat CellCorrect

Format Cell is accessible in Interactive View mode, permitting basic cell-level formatting changes to be made without requiring a switch to Edit mode.

DMerge Dimensions

Merge Dimensions is a data-modeling operation that modifies the report's underlying data structure and is only available in Edit mode, not in Interactive View mode.
